Austrian retail traders who want to trade forex and CFDs in euro-based or global markets often face a choice between FxPro and RoboForex. FxPro, founded in 2006, is a well-established broker with a strong reputation and a score of 4.1/5. It provides access to MetaTrader 4, MetaTrader 5, and cTrader, making it ideal for traders in Vienna, Graz, or Salzburg who demand stable execution and transparent pricing. RoboForex, founded in 2009, scores 3.2/5 and appeals to a more flexibility-driven audience with high leverage up to 1:2000, numerous account types, and the ability to deposit using USDT TRC20. Austrian traders are accustomed to reliable banking via Bank Transfer, Skrill, and Neteller, and both brokers support these methods. However, the local financial regulator, the Austrian Financial Market Authority (FMA), does not directly supervise these brokers, so Austrian clients must rely on the brokers' respective licenses – FCA, CySEC, and IFSC – for protection. This comparison evaluates spreads, platforms, deposit speed, Islamic accounts, and support in the context of Austrian trading habits.

Execution quality is crucial for Austrian traders who scalp or use automated trading. FxPro uses a no-dealing-desk (NDD) model alongside Straight-Through-Processing (STP) for its Raw account, offering average execution speeds down to 20 milliseconds. RoboForex also uses STP/ECN execution, but the broker’s technical infrastructure is less standardized across servers, with latency spikes noted by some traders during high-impact news. Austrian traders connected to European servers will find lower latency with FxPro because the broker has servers in LD4 and Equinix. RoboForex’s servers are primarily in New York and Frankfurt, which is acceptable but not ideal for Austrian-based scalpers. Overall, FxPro provides more consistent execution and fewer requotes.

FxPro is regulated by the FCA, CySEC, and multiple other authorities, which gives Austrian traders a European pillar of safety through MiFID II and the Investor Compensation Fund. RoboForex is regulated by the International Financial Services Commission (IFSC) of Belize and the FSA of Saint Vincent and the Grenadines, which are offshore regulators. The Austrian Financial Market Authority (FMA) cannot step in if disputes arise with either broker, but FxPro offers the possibility of referring complaints to the Financial Ombudsman in Cyprus, which covers EU clients. Austrian traders should be aware that only FxPro offers negative balance protection under CySEC rules, a crucial safeguard for high-leverage positions. RoboForex has negative balance protection on its own terms but it is not enforced by a local EU regulator.

Austrian traders can deposit and withdraw at FxPro and RoboForex using Bank Transfer, Skrill, Neteller, and USDT TRC20. At FxPro, SEPA bank transfers are free and usually arrive within 1-2 business days, while Skrill and Neteller deposits are instant. Withdrawals at FxPro via Skrill or Neteller are processed within 24 hours. RoboForex also supports SEPA transfers, but bank withdrawals may take up to 3 days and can carry a fee if the account is inactive. USDT TRC20 deposits are a standout feature at RoboForex, with zero blockchain fees and near-instant processing, while FxPro added USDT TRC20 for selected clients but with a longer verification queue. Austrian traders should always fund their trading account from the same bank account or e-wallet used for verification to avoid AML delays. Both brokers require standard KYC documents such as a passport or Austrian national ID and proof of address.

Austrian Muslim traders can access swap-free accounts at both brokers, which is essential for those observing Sharia law. FxPro offers no swap or interest charges on its Standard, Raw, and cTrader accounts for unlimited periods. RoboForex also provides Islamic accounts on MT4 and MT5, but Austrian clients need to submit a request via email or live chat, and a small administrative fee may appear if the account holds a position for more than 3 consecutive nights. Both brokers maintain the same spreads on Islamic accounts as on regular accounts, which is a positive for Austrian traders. FxPro’s longer-standing history and stronger regulation make its Islamic account more trustworthy for Austrian residents.
